NAME

pod2wiki - A utility to convert Pod documents to Wiki format.

SYNOPSIS

pod2wiki [--style --noerrata --help --man] podfile [outfile]

    Options:
        --style      wiki style (defaults to wiki. See --help)
        --noerrata   don't generate a "POD ERRORS" section
        --help       brief help message
        --man        full documentation

OPTIONS

podfile

The input file that contains the Pod file to be converted. It can also be stdin.

outfile

The converted output file in wiki format. Defaults to stdout if not specified.

--style or -s

Sets the wiki style of the output. If no style is specified the program defaults to wiki. The available options are:

wiki

This is the original Wiki format as used on Ward Cunningham's Portland repository of Patterns. The formatting rules are given at http://c2.com/cgi/wiki?TextFormattingRules

kwiki

This is the format as used by Brian Ingerson's CGI::Kwiki: http://search.cpan.org/dist/CGI-Kwiki/

usemod

This is the format used by the Usemod wikis. See: http://www.usemod.com/cgi-bin/wiki.pl?WikiFormat

twiki

This is the format used by TWiki wikis. See: http://www.twiki.org/

wikipedia or mediawiki

This is the format used by Wikipedia and MediaWiki wikis. See: http://www.wikipedia.org/

--noerrata or -noe

Don't generate a "POD ERRORS" section at the end of the document. Equivalent to the Pod::Simple::no_errata_section() method.

--help or -h

Print a brief help message and exits.

--man or -m

Prints the manual page and exits.

DESCRIPTION

This program is used for converting Pod text to Wiki text.

Pod is Perl's Plain Old Documentation format. See man perlpod or perldoc perlpod.

A Wiki is a user extensible web site. It uses very simple mark-up that is converted to Html.
